虚拟机Win2000联网故障解决方案
虚拟机win2000不能上网

首页 2025-02-14 21:17:18



解决虚拟机Win2000无法上网的难题:深度剖析与实战指南 在信息化快速发展的今天,虚拟化技术已经成为企业IT架构中不可或缺的一部分

    虚拟机不仅能够有效提高硬件资源的利用率,还能为开发、测试、部署等多种场景提供灵活便捷的环境

    然而,在使用虚拟机的过程中,我们时常会遇到各种问题,其中虚拟机Win2000无法上网的问题尤为常见且棘手

    本文将深度剖析这一问题,并提供一套切实可行的解决方案,旨在帮助广大用户快速排除故障,恢复虚拟机的网络连接

     一、问题背景与影响 Windows 2000(简称Win2000)作为微软早期的一款经典操作系统,虽然已逐渐退出历史舞台,但在某些特定领域(如老旧软件的运行、历史数据的处理等)仍发挥着不可替代的作用

    当我们在现代硬件或虚拟化平台上运行Win2000时,网络连接问题尤为突出

    这不仅会严重影响工作效率,还可能导致关键业务的中断,给企业带来不可估量的损失

     二、问题原因分析 虚拟机Win2000无法上网的原因复杂多样,主要可以归结为以下几个方面: 1.虚拟机网络配置不当:虚拟机软件(如VMware、VirtualBox等)提供了多种网络模式(如桥接、NAT、Host-Only等),每种模式都有其特定的应用场景和配置要求

    若配置不当,将导致虚拟机无法正确接入网络

     2.Win2000系统网络设置问题:Win2000的网络配置相对复杂,包括TCP/IP协议的设置、DNS服务器的配置等

    若这些设置不正确,虚拟机将无法解析域名或建立有效的网络连接

     3.宿主机网络环境问题:宿主机的网络状态直接影响虚拟机的网络连接

    若宿主机存在网络故障(如网卡驱动问题、防火墙设置不当等),将间接导致虚拟机无法上网

     4.虚拟网卡与驱动问题:虚拟机通过虚拟网卡与宿主机进行网络通信

    若虚拟网卡驱动不兼容或损坏,将导致虚拟机无法识别网络硬件,进而无法上网

     5.安全软件与防火墙干扰:宿主机和虚拟机上的安全软件(如杀毒软件、防火墙等)可能误判虚拟网络流量,导致网络连接被阻断

     三、解决方案与实践 针对上述原因,我们可以采取以下步骤逐一排查并解决问题: 1. 检查虚拟机网络配置 - 确认网络模式:根据实际需求选择合适的网络模式

    如需虚拟机直接访问外部网络,可选择桥接模式;若只需虚拟机与宿主机通信,可选择Host-Only模式;NAT模式则适用于虚拟机访问外部网络而隐藏真实IP地址的场景

     - 检查网络适配器设置:确保虚拟机的网络适配器已正确连接,并配置了正确的MAC地址和IP地址(如果使用静态IP)

     2. 调整Win2000系统网络设置 - TCP/IP协议配置:进入Win2000的“控制面板”->“网络和拨号连接”->“本地连接”->“属性”->“Internet协议(TCP/IP)”,确保已勾选“使用下面的IP地址”和“使用下面的DNS服务器地址”,并输入正确的IP、子网掩码、网关和DNS服务器地址

     - DNS设置:确保DNS服务器地址正确无误,且DNS服务器能够正常解析域名

     3. 检查宿主机网络环境 - 网卡驱动与状态:检查宿主机的网卡驱动是否安装正确,网卡是否处于启用状态,以及是否存在硬件故障

     - 防火墙与安全软件:暂时禁用宿主机的防火墙和安全软件,观察虚拟机是否能正常上网

    若问题解决,则需调整防火墙规则或安全软件设置,允许虚拟网络流量通过

     4. 更新或修复虚拟网卡驱动 - 检查驱动版本:确保虚拟网卡驱动与虚拟机软件版本兼容,并尝试更新到最新版本

     - 重新安装驱动:若驱动损坏,可在虚拟机软件中卸载虚拟网卡,然后重新安装最新驱动

     5. 排除安全软件干扰 - 调整虚拟机防火墙设置:在虚拟机中检查防火墙设置,确保允许必要的网络访问

     - 禁用不必要的服务:关闭虚拟机中不必要的网络服务,减少网络流量和潜在的安全风险

     四、实战案例分享 以下是一个真实的案例,展示了如何逐步解决虚拟机Win2000无法上网的问题: 某企业因业务需要,在VMware Workstation上安装了一台Win2000虚拟机

    配置完成后,发现虚拟机无法访问外部网络

    经过检查,发现虚拟机被配置为NAT模式,但宿主机上的VMware NAT服务未启动

    启动该服务后,虚拟机仍无法上网

    进一步排查发现,Win2000的TCP/IP协议配置错误,IP地址与宿主机在同一网段内,导致IP冲突

    将虚拟机的IP地址修改为不同网段后,问题得到解决

     五、总结与预防 虚拟机Win2000无法上网的问题虽然复杂,但只要我们掌握了正确的排查方法和解决技巧,就能迅速定位问题并予以解决

    为了预防类似问题的再次发生,建议采取以下措施: - 定期备份虚拟机配置:定期备份虚拟机的配置文件和系统状态,以便在出现问题时能够快速恢复

     - 更新虚拟机软件与驱动:及时更新虚拟机软件和虚拟网卡驱动,确保与操作系统的兼容性

     - 加强网络安全管理:合理配置防火墙和安全软件规则,避免误判虚拟网络流量

     - 定期检查网络环境:定期检查宿主机和虚拟机的网络环境,确保网络配置正确无误

     通过以上措施的实施,我们可以有效降低虚拟机Win2000无法上网问题的发生率,确保虚拟化环境的稳定性和可靠性

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道